jdforrester wrote on 2014-04-21 19:37:34 (UTC)

This is about being able to use login.wikimedia.org as an OpenID provider into Phabricator (and only allowing that for account creation); depending on which versions of the protocol Phabricator uses and works with, this is either trivial configuration or requires a huge amount of work. :-)

There's the added complication of merging import-related accounts into these ones, but that's a task we've got ahead of ourselves anyway.
